Jim's radio tower yields consequences which rock him to his very core. The hole that Tabitha has been digging leads her somewhere - and to someone - she could never have expected. Everything is about to change.

Season 1 finale and what I expect for seasons ahead
by AfricanBro2022-04-26

"Alright the season finished not too long ago now, it ends with more questions than it answers but it's a pretty decent season. We learn so much more of where they're stranded but nothing to help us understand it better. Probably did it for the suspense to have us eager for s2. I increased my rating from a 6, not the best show out there but it's a good horror watch. It didn't give out any answers but so much more is uncovered which leads to several possible storylines for the next season. If it follows this trajectory it's gonna end up being a really good show.
